Helping shape the energy supply of the future

For 45 years, we have been working to make energy independent, secure, and economically viable. Today, SMA is one of the world’s leading specialists in photovoltaic system technology and energy management. Around 3,500 employees in 19 countries develop solutions for a reliable and affordable energy supply.

What began as a pioneering idea has helped advance photovoltaics worldwide. SMA has contributed to making solar energy an established and cost-effective energy source today. We connect photovoltaics, storage, e-mobility, and energy management into intelligent, integrated systems. These systems reduce electricity costs. They stabilize grids—for example through grid-forming inverters and black-start capability. And they protect digital infrastructure from the outset, following the principle of “security by design.”

With over 1,600 patents, award-winning technology, and a strong global partner network, SMA is one of the industry’s innovative system providers. We are a reliable partner for companies, municipal utilities, energy providers, and both private and commercial system operators worldwide.

What started as a pioneering idea has become a globally active company. The driving force remains the same: making energy more independent, secure, and economical—through a systemic approach and practical implementation.

Facts and Figures

Headquarters: Niestetal, Germany

Global presence: sales and service subsidiaries in 19 countries

Founded: 1981

Number of employees: over 3,500

Sales 2025: 1,516 million euros

SMA - A Pioneer in PV and Storage System Technology for 40 Years..

1987

SMA develops the first transistor inverter for photovoltaics. 

1995

With the development of string technology, SMA paves the way for the mass distribution of photovoltaics.

2001

Sunny Island delivers an autonomous electricity supply to off off-grid areas. 

2002

SMA develops multi multi-string technology making highly efficient control of differently developed module threads possible with only one inverter inverter.

2011

Sunny Tripower is the first inverter to achieve 99% efficiency. 

2013

The SMA Fuel Save Solution integrates large PV shares into diesel grids.

2015

For the first time, the Sunny Home Manager integrates household appliances into the energy management system via EEBUS.

2016

Sunny Boy Storage is the first AC AC-coupled system to integrate high high-voltage batteries.

2017

Sunny Tripower CORE1 is the first freefree-standing string inverter. 

2018

With ennexOS , SMA establishes the first IoT platform for cross cross-sector energy management.

2019

Sunny Central UP delivers 50% more power than its predecessor and integrates larglargestorage systems. 

...With a Global Presence and Strong Partners

2000

The first foreign subsidiary is launched in the U.S. Many more will follow in subsequent years.

2008

SMA achieves the year's largest IPO. 

2009

The world’s largest carbon carbon-neutral inverter factory begins operations.

2013

SMA partners with MieleMiele, Stiebel Eltron and Vaillant in the field of energy management.

2014

SMA enters into a strategic partnership with Danfoss. Danfoss becomes SMA’s anchor investor.

2017

SMA and MVV Energie AG jointly develop SMA SPOT for direct selling of solar power.

2018

SMA founds its subsidiary coneva to develop white label solutions for the energy industry.

2018

SMA and Audi collaborate on integrating e-mobility into domestic energy management.
